Serving the Steaks

To serve filet mignon on a Blackstone griddle, you will need:

  • 2 filet mignon steaks, 1 inch thick
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, chopped

Instructions:

1. Heat the Blackstone griddle to medium-high heat.
2. Add the olive oil to the griddle.
3. Sear the steaks for 3-4 minutes per side, or until desired doneness is reached.
4. Transfer the steaks to a cutting board and let rest for 5 minutes before serving.
5. In a small sa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at.
6. Add the garlic powder and rosemary and cook for 1 minute, or until fragrant.
7. Pour the butter sauce over the steaks and serve immediately.

What temperature should I cook filet mignon on a Blackstone griddle?

The ideal temperature for cooking filet mignon on a Blackstone griddle is medium-high heat, or around 400 degrees Fahrenheit. This will allow the filet mignon to sear quickly and evenly, while still resulting in a juicy and flavorful steak.

How long do I cook filet mignon on a Blackstone griddle?

The cooking time for filet mignon on a Blackstone griddle will vary depending on the thickness of the steak. For a 1-inch thick filet mignon, cook for 3-4 minutes per side, or until cooked to your desired doneness. For a 2-inch thick filet mignon, cook for 4-5 minutes per side.
